Differential Calculus
The Greek mathematician Archimedes was
the first to find the tangent to a curve, other than a circle, in a method akin
to differential calculus. While studying the spiral, he separated a point's
motion into two components, one radial motion component and one circular motion
component, and then continued to add the two component motions together thereby
finding the tangent to the curve . The Indian mathematician-astronomer Aryabhata in
499 used a notion of infinitesimals and
expressed an astronomical problem in the form of a basic differential Equations.Integral CalculusComputing volumes and zones, the fundamental
